Output d66ddb97a1ab7345c6c078481d68c8d841f51f47292012897aff75552071b716:66

value
3876538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561c9f98b641b7fc4065a684c0d74f46d627e44d OP_EQUAL
address
39YLKqBXUc8vFRvrDrFePveCxZcxjotHTb
transaction
d66ddb97a1ab7345c6c078481d68c8d841f51f47292012897aff75552071b716
spent
true